in

Evitando el robo de imágenes

En relación a un post anterior, el buen Mariano Amartino, autor del blog Denken Über, me ha obsequiado este post en exclusiva para Isopixel. Disfrutenlo y que me disculpe Antonio por el fusil descarado el Blogguest ;).

Evitando el robo de imágenes

Lo que describe Vuarnet en el post “Robando Ancho de Banda” se llama “HOTLINKING” y es cuando alguien, desde un site/blog/foro o lo que sea, no quiere subir imágenes a su propio servidor para no gastar ancho de banda; entonces lo que hace es buscar una imagen en internet y, mediante el tag IMG, incluirla en su propio site pero tomándola desde el servidor del site “víctima” en este caso fue Iso, en muchos casos so yo, etc.

¿Pero que tiene de malo que te saquen una imagencita? Se preguntarán. Básicamente tiene de malo que uno debe pagar por el uso del ancho de banda entonces muchas veces terminas pagando por algo que alguien (sin siquiera pedir permiso o darte crédito) te está robando.

Por otro lado, con la cantidad de servicios gratuitos para hostear imágenes que hay en internet esto es simplemente vagancia.

La solución más completa es evitar que tus archivos puedan ser mostrados cuando es “otro server” el que lo está “llamando” mediante unas muy pequeñas modificaciones al archivo .htaccess de tu sitio (Creanme tarde o temprano todos terminan aprendiendo como manejar este archivo).

Modificando tu .htaccess
Si ya tenés un .htaccess en tu servidor, solo tenés que copiar las siguientes líneas en el:


RewriteEngine On
RewriteCond %{HTTP_REFERER} !^$
RewriteCond %{HTTP_REFERER} !^http://PON-EL-NOMBRE-DE-TU-DOMINIO.com [NC]
RewriteCond %{HTTP_REFERER} !^http://www.PON-EL-NOMBRE-DE-TU-DOMINIO.com [NC]
RewriteRule .*\.(gif|jpg|jpeg|swf|png)$ - [NC,F]

Si querés ser un poco mas “agresivo y que en el site que hizo el hotlinking aparezca una imagen (como la que puso Isopixel en la subasta de deremate) sólo tenés que cambiar la última línea del ejemplo de arriba por esta otra:

RewriteRule .*\.(gif|jpg)$ http://PON-EL-NOMBRE-DE-TU-DOMINIO/bad-image.gif [R,NC]

Y luego crea una imagen (agresiva o no) con el nombre bad-image.gif subela a tu server y listo.

Creando un .htaccess
Y si no tenes un .htaccess en tu server, sólo tenes que:
1- Abrir un Notepad
2- Copiar estas líneas cambiando los datos por los de tu site
3- Guardarlo como .htaccess
4- Subirlo via FTP a tu server
5- Renombralo por las dudas a “.htaccess” (sin las comillas)

Y listo.

Más información sobre HTACCESS
Freewebmaster Helo: http://www.freewebmasterhelp.com/tutorials/htaccess/
Apache HTACCESS Howto: http://httpd.apache.org/docs/howto/htaccess.html

No olvides seguirnos y comentar en Twitter y Facebook

Por Raúl Ramírez

Tech journalist, diseñador, blogger, marketing digital. Editor en jefe en https://isopixel.net. Colaboro en @Nibble20. Speaker, marketing, gadgeteer & serial geek.